However, exfat_remove_entries() is also called from the rename and move paths (exfat_rename_file and exfat_move_file), where the old entry set is being relocated rather than deleted. This causes benign secondary entries such as vendor extension entries to be silently destroyed on rename or cross-directory move, violating the exFAT spec requirement (section 8.2) that implementations preserve unrecognized benign secondary entries. Fix this by adding a free_benign parameter to exfat_remove_entries() so callers can suppress cluster freeing during relocation, and extending exfat_init_ext_entry() to copy trailing benign secondary entries from the old entry set into the new one internally. Also clean up the error paths to delete newly allocated entries on failure.
